Where Do We Go From Here?
Are you worried about getting children and teens back into the library post-COVID? You aren’t alone! A community-based approach will help you expand your reach to patrons new and old, so in this webinar we’ll
talk about Community Asset Mapping, a strategy that will help you discover and develop new partnerships.
Presenters: Beth Yates, Children’s Consultant, Indiana State Library and Christy Franzman, Teen Coordinator, Hamilton East Public Library, Indiana.
